Winds of Valen is a fantasy MMORPG inspired by the golden age of old school MMOs like Old School RuneScape. Explore an open world with meaningful, non-linear progression, where your progression is driven by what you choose to pursue.
Step into a living world with no set path. Choose your own adventures, travel in any direction, and play at your own pace.
Take on challenging, mechanics-driven boss encounters and earn powerful gear.
Train and master your skills:
Combat Skills: Attack, Archery, Magic, Defence, Evasion, Warding and Health
Professions: Mining, Smithing, Fishing and Potion making, deeply tied into your equipment, upgrades, and overall progression.
Gather resources, smelt ore, and craft powerful gear. Every tool and weapon has purpose.
Every monster in Winds of Valen drops its own rare, unique item.
Rare drop chances are displayed openly and dynamically change to prevent getting too unlucky
Every item is balanced, useful, and designed to have its place in the world.
Winds of Valen is free to play with many hours of free content to enjoy. However, If you want to expand your journey, purchasing a membership pass grants account-wide access to members-only content, expanded bank storage, and a vote on future game updates. as shown below. 
Winds of Valen is built for players who enjoy the open-ended, sandbox design of old-school MMOs.
